Identification and prediction of ALS subgroups using machine learning

2021-04-07

Abstract excerpt

<h4>SUMMARY</h4> <h4>Background</h4> The disease entity known as amyotrophic lateral sclerosis (ALS) is now known to represent a collection of overlapping syndromes. A better understanding of this heterogeneity and the ability to distinguish ALS subtypes would improve the clinical care of patients and enhance our understanding of the disease.
